- Is Rineyville or Vine Grove safer?
- Vine Grove has the lower violent crime rate. Rineyville reports 704/100k and Vine Grove reports 497/100k (violent crimes per 100,000 residents).
- Are homes cheaper in Rineyville or Vine Grove?
- The median home value is $215k in Rineyville and $191k in Vine Grove, so homes are more affordable in Vine Grove.
